EMT Salary in Maine (2026)
$22.28 per hour · take-home ≈ $37,110/year ($3,093/month) for a single filer
Maine ranks 17th of 51 states for EMT pay, with a median about 6% above the national average. Of the 1,110 EMT jobs BLS counts in Maine, the typical worker earns $46,340 a year — though pay ranges from $38,210 for newcomers to $58,100 at the top.
EMT pay range in Maine
| Percentile | Annual wage | Meaning |
| 10th percentile (entry) | $38,210 | Lowest-paid 10% earn less than this |
| 25th percentile | $42,000 | A quarter earn less |
| Median (50th) | $46,340 | Half earn more, half earn less |
| 75th percentile | $49,080 | Top quarter starts here |
| 90th percentile (top) | $58,100 | Highest-paid 10% earn more than this |
BLS reports 1,110 EMT jobs in Maine (occupation code 29-2042, “Emergency Medical Technicians”).
Gross vs. take-home in Maine
A median EMT salary of $46,340 doesn’t all reach your bank account. After federal income tax, Social Security, and Medicare, plus Maine state income tax, a single filer keeps about $37,110 — an effective tax rate of 19.9%.
| Gross (median) | $46,340 |
| Federal income tax | −$3,381 |
| Social Security + Medicare | −$3,545 |
| Maine state income tax | −$2,304 |
| Take-home (annual) | $37,110 |
| Take-home (monthly) | $3,093 |

Sources and methodology
Wage and employment figures: BLS OEWS May 2025 (state file, released April 2026) — the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ics survey, the most authoritative public salary dataset. Take-home estimate: 2026 federal brackets, FICA, and verified Maine state tax rules (single filer, standard deduction, no credits or local taxes). Estimates only — not financial advice.
